Located in historic Pennsylvania, The Quarters at The Shook s a 45 bed personal care facility in the heart of downtown Chambersburg. Our homey, friendly community is designed to provide you with the personal assistance that you need, yet give you the freedom that you deserve during your retirement years. Located in Franklin County, Chambersburg is the county seat and is a town rich in heritage and influence.

Professional, caring staff provide 24 hour nursing support with all of the comforts of home. Residents are provided prepared meals and assisted with housekeeping, and scheduled local transportation. Personal care staff can see that your daily needs are met with the best of care.


The Quarters at The Shook offers Private Rooms as well as Deluxe Private Rooms and Deluxe Comfort Suites. The Quarters encourages residents to continue to live an enjoyable lifestyle while providing assistance with activities of daily living to those who need a little help.

Hospice Care

Hospice is a special way of caring for people with terminal illnesses and their families. A terminal illness can cause many reactions, including: pain and discomfort, fear and loneliness and anxiety about what lies ahead with regard to their illnesses. Hospice strives to meet all of the nursing home resident’s needs…physical, emotional, social and spiritual.

A team provides care for the resident. It’s not possible for one person to meet all of the needs of a seriously ill person. Hospice uses a team approach. They work along with the Shook Home team well as their own team members to work together for the good of the patient and the family.

Respite Care

Respite care provides time off for family members who care for someone who is ill, injured or frail. Caregivers face many challenges. Caregiving is a demanding task and it is easy to neglect your own needs and health issues when caring for a loved one. Caregiver’s need time off for vacations, for dealing with their own health needs and to prevent stress and caregiver burnout. Effective caregiving depends on meeting the caregiver’s own needs for rest and support. Respite care provides caregivers with a planned and temporary break from their responsibilities of care giving.

Respite care provides a safe, warm environment for your loved one when you need a break with caregiving responsibilities. The Shook Home and The Quarters can provide 24 hour a day, temporary care in our skilled care nursing home or in our personal care facility at The Quarters.
